Melbourne's Fed Square will not show World Cup games for the first time in more than 20 years

Football Australia has urged the Victorian government to reverse a ban on World Cup matches being shown on big screens at Melbourne's Federation Square.

Australia supporters have gathered there to watch tournament matches since 2006.

However, the Melbourne Arts Precinct, which manages the venue, said behaviour in previous years had been "unacceptable and damaging".

Video of fans celebrating went viral during the 2022 World Cup in Qatar as Australia advanced to the last 16, but there were incidents involving people being injured by flares and projectiles.
